Understanding what the Studio Tour is and isn’t

Visitors at times arrive anticipating a topic park, even trying to find “London Harry Potter Universal Studios.” There is no Universal Studios park in London. The Warner Bros Studio Tour is a at the back of-the-scenes revel in in Leavesden, kind of 20 miles northwest of relevant London, in which lots of the sequence turned into filmed. Think units and props, not curler coasters. You’ll walk because of the Great Hall, Dumbledore’s Office, Diagon Alley, and the Forbidden Forest. You can step onto Platform nine¾ beside the Hogwarts Express, peek at creature resultseasily, and stand below the Whomping Willow’s branches. Outdoors, climate enabling, you’ll see Privet Drive and the Knight Bus. The knowledge is linear yet self-paced: such a lot americans spend 3 to four hours interior, even supposing that you can linger longer if your entry time is early inside the day.

The seasonal rhythm: what ameliorations throughout the year

The Studio does an admirable activity of preserving the adventure fresh with rotating elements and seasonal overlays. The two gigantic recurring movements:

Dark Arts in autumn: Usually past due September due to early November. Expect floating pumpkins in the Great Hall, Death Eater duels, and moodier lighting fixtures. It’s atmospheric, noticeably round dusk. Demand will increase as Halloween ways, so London Harry Potter studio journey tickets for October weekends can sell out weeks in advance. Hogwarts within the Snow in winter: Typically mid-November as a result of mid-January. Snow-dusted sets, timber twinkling with lighting, and a festive Great Hall. This is a wonderful time for families and photographers. It could also be peak for the vacation season, with pricing and availability reflecting that.

Spring and summer season tutor fewer overlays yet convey their very own benefits. Late spring has longer daytime and milder climate, which makes the backyard backlot sets greater comfy and the stroll returned to the shuttle less dreary. Summer holidays, exceedingly overdue July and August, are the so much crowded period. You nonetheless savour the complete Warner Bros Harry Potter expertise, but foremost slots vanish immediate and also you’ll proportion the Butterbeer bar with many greater humans.

If you prefer the fewest crowds and comparatively clean price tag availability, target midweek days in January (after faculty vacations quit), early February, and early March. For nice climate with out top crowds, overdue April to early June on a Tuesday or Wednesday works smartly. The shoulder duration on the end of summer time, early September until now UK schools resume solely, may well be enormously excellent too, although nevertheless busy when compared with past due wintry weather.

Days of the week and time of day

Weekends fill first, with Saturdays the busiest. Sundays are purely marginally quieter. Fridays many times behave like weekends whenever you hit institution vacations. For the calmest knowledge, go Tuesday or Wednesday. Thursday is a possible fallback. If you must move on a weekend, get the earliest access you would and plan to maneuver quickly simply by the first hour.

Time of day shapes your adventure interior. The earliest access, ordinarilly 9 or nine:30 inside the morning, unlocks the top hazard to peer the Great Hall with fewer workers. You’ll also beat the day’s cumulative crowd construct-up. If mornings aren’t your issue, the very last entries might possibly be quiet as effectively, yet you’ll have much less time given that the Studio has a ultimate hour: access team of workers will remind you to continue shifting. Families tend to cluster mid-morning to mid-afternoon. School groups are maximum standard on weekdays all the way through term, quite often in late morning. If you might be touchy to noise and congestion, you would notice a big difference between 10:30 and 13:00 versus the very first or very last slots.

One small tactic that works: in case your time table allows, purchase the second one or 3rd access slot of the day other than the absolute first. The starting wave in the main attracts every person who wishes an empty Great Hall, which satirically creates an early pinch at the 1st few sets. Arriving a dash later we could that surge disperse so that you can loop through the Great Hall, Hogwarts Express, and the Forbidden Forest with greater respiring room. The business-off is you’ll see moderately more workers on your early photos.

School vacations and 1/2-terms

Crowds on the Harry Potter Studio Tour UK are enormously correlated with tuition calendars. UK half of-terms normally fall in late October, mid to late February, and overdue May, with longer breaks at Christmas and in summer season. Many international viewers arrive throughout their own faculty vacation trips as neatly. If your tour dates are fixed inside of these windows, e book London Harry Potter studio tickets as soon as you've got flights and motels established. For flexible tourists, transferring your talk over with by means of simply one week can cut the gang distinctly and open up larger time slots.

Keep an eye fixed on specified launch drops. When the Studio broadcasts a new characteristic or provides multiplied hours near top-demand dates, added tickets may occur. Signing up for alerts supports.

Getting there without drama

The studio sits near Watford Junction. From London Euston, immediate trains take roughly 20 mins, slower trains as much as forty five. At Watford Junction, a branded commute bus runs to the Studio in about 15 mins. You desire your reserving confirmation to board and you pay a small payment for the shuttle, contactless conventional. Pad your agenda with a 15 to twenty minute buffer for show hiccups. If your entry time is 10:00, goal to be at Euston with the aid of eight:forty five or nine:00. Travel on weekends every now and then involves engineering works, lengthening adventure occasions, so determine schedules the day formerly.

If you opt for a educate package deal, prefer a good operator supplying transparent departure instances. Some get started near Victoria, Baker Street, or King’s Cross. For communities and households, the tutor would be less demanding. For solo travelers or the ones staying close to Euston, the instruct-commute combo is rapid.

Common pitfalls and find out how to preclude them

People underestimate transit time. A couple of minutes past due to your time slot is most of the time great, but good sized delays can rationale access issues. Build buffers into each ends of the journey, enormously when you've got theatre tickets that nighttime, like the London Harry Potter play.

Some traffic think identical-day tickets are you will. They from time to time are on off-top midweeks, but not reliably. If you’re traveling from overseas or have a decent schedule, don’t gamble. London Harry Potter studio tickets for weekends and vacations vanish early.

Others be expecting rides or loose-waft pictures area at all hours. It’s a customary appeal. Assume you’ll percentage the first-class angles. Patience and moderate time table tweaks make a colossal big difference.

Finally, folk try to combine too many London Harry Potter areas into one day: the Studio, numerous filming locations, a jogging excursion, and a overdue play. You can do it, but it will become a marathon. Choose two considerable ingredients and delight in them accurately.
